US Existing Home Sales MoM (Jan) M/M -8.4% (Prev. 4.4%, Rev. From 5.1%)

Today's report indicated a significant drop in US existing home sales for January, down 8.4% month-over-month, marking a stark contrast from the previous increase of 4.4%.
